Party-Planning Tips
- Create a “Butler’s Pantry” – Make a dedicated shelf or storage rack for party essentials. Trays, ice buckets, napkins, tablecloths, acrylic glassware. Have this butler’s pantry in your basement or garage. Not only does it keep you more organized, but it also frees up space inside. It all stays in one place and out of the way. Instant organization = instant hostess win!!
- Have an Outdoor Party Stash – Keep your beach chairs, foldable picnic tables, umbrellas, cushions, and coolers all in one spot. I even keep beach towels in a tub near right next to my butler’s pantry. Who wants to look in a linen closet in the dead of winter and see beach towels?
- Cocktails by the Door – Greet guests with a drink as soon as they walk in! Make sure you have a spot to put these. A small tablet or cabinet. Dress it up to match the mood! As the party winds down, swap it out with party favors (bonus points if they’re my wine glasses). When favors go out, it’s time for guests to make their way out!
- Make a Batch Cocktail – Saves time and keeps the drinks flowing! I love sangria (check out my fave recipe). What really helps is to keep a few ingredients handy at all times, like champagne and canned fruit juices, coconut juice, simple syrup, lime juice etc.
- Keep Ice in the Freezer – Always. You never know when you’ll need it, and I use it up before it gets in my way every time.
- Embrace Food Shortcuts – Market-made apps and desserts? Yes, please!! Or, have guests bring a dish or a charcuterie tray. This is where any hostess spends the bulk of her time, which is why most hostesses are exhausted before guests arrive. Just focus on a great cocktail setup! Because let’s be honest, hearing that cocktail shaker makes everyone forget the appetizers came from the store.

- Label Your Dishes – Use post-it notes to label your dishes with what goes in each and have serving spoons/forks out. No trying to remember why you grabbed those two bowls. No last-minute scrambling!
- Get the Music Ready – Have your Spotify playlist set before guests arrive. The right vibe makes all the difference!
- Contain Pets & Kids – If little ones are coming, hire a babysitter and set up a mocktail station just for them. It gives your guests a break to enjoy the party and offers something fun for the kiddos to enjoy. Give your pet a safe space. Even if they love guests, this is not the time to risk a runaway pup!

- A Spot for Bags & Jackets – Ensure you have a dedicated spot. This keeps clutter out of the way and makes it easy for guests to grab their things when they head out.
- Extra Trash Cans = Less Mess – No one wants to hunt for a trash bin. Set a few around for easy cleanup!
- Start Cleaning Up at End Time – Always set an end time! When it comes, gently start tidying by gathering used glasses. It helps guests get the hint without being pushy.
